01Research and Identify the Issue
- The first step in running a successful grassroots campaign is to thoroughly research and identify the issue or cause you are passionate about.
- Gather data, statistics, and other relevant information to build a strong case for your campaign.
- Identify the key stakeholders, influencers, and decision-makers involved in the issue.
- Understanding the issue inside out will help you formulate a compelling message and strategy for your campaign.
02Build a Strong Network
- A strong grassroots campaign relies on building a robust network of supporters and volunteers.
- Reach out to like-minded individuals, community organizations, and local businesses that align with your campaign's goals.
- Host events, meetings, and seminars to connect with potential supporters and engage them in your cause.
- Nurture these relationships and provide opportunities for your network to actively participate in the campaign.
03Develop a Compelling Message
- Craft a compelling message that clearly articulates your campaign's goals, values, and the impact you aim to create.
- Tailor your message to resonate with your target audience and inspire them to take action.
- Use storytelling, visuals, and emotional appeals to convey the importance of your cause and why it matters to everyone.
- Ensure consistency in your message across all campaign materials and platforms.
04Mobilize and Activate Supporters
- A successful grassroots campaign relies on the active participation and support of its volunteers and supporters.
- Develop clear calls to action and provide easy ways for people to get involved.
- Organize rallies, protests, and community events to mobilize and energize your supporters.
- Utilize social media and online platforms to reach a wider audience and expand your campaign's reach.
05Collaborate with Other Organizations
- Building alliances and collaborating with other organizations can significantly amplify the impact of your grassroots campaign.
- Identify and forge partnerships with organizations that share similar goals or have overlapping interests.
- Co-host events, share resources, and support each other's initiatives to create a unified front.
- Pooling resources, expertise, and networks can strengthen your campaign's effectiveness and broaden its reach.
